FAQ: How do I use the Gravwell GPU memory profiler?

Gravwell attaches to any training job on the Ferncliff cluster and samples allocator state every 50ms, producing per-kernel fragmentation reports. Enable it with the profiling flag in your job spec; overhead is roughly 3%. Be careful interpreting peak figures: cached blocks are counted unless you pass the strict-accounting option. Reports land in the shared profiling bucket, which is encrypted at rest. To decrypt older reports, the archive's recovery passphrase is provided below.

vault phrase of kafog-kahif = holdor-rusir-praox

## Artifact Signing — Drifthound Investigation Builds

All builds of the Drifthound cron-drift analyzer must be signed before the scheduler nodes will load them. This came out of the March incident where an unsigned probe skewed drift measurements by several minutes. Reviewers should confirm the signature step runs after the reproducibility check, not before. CI signs automatically on tagged commits, but local test builds require manually signing with the key below.

deploy key for kajof-fajop: bky6_gDHw9Q

## Image Cache Leak — Limits

The Brindle thumbnail cache leaks under sustained eviction pressure; fix is pending. Until then, hard caps are enforced on cache size and entry lifetime, and the worker restarts when resident memory crosses the ceiling. Do not raise these during an incident. Current enforced limits are set here.

tuning table, hafog-bahaf:
QUOTAS = {
    "praion": 144,
    "briax": 906,
    "silwyn": 451,
}